Stress washing is frequently utilized to tidy structures, paved surfaces and devices on campus. Stress cleaning can negatively influence water quality if not done appropriately. Usage dry techniques such as mops, blowers or street sweepers to cleanse the area before using a stress washing machine on any kind of surface. Block off storm drains first to stop debris from entering.


EHS has actually usually discovered that making use of chemicals does not boost the outcome. Cost cost savings can be substantial without making use of chemicals, because the wastewater usually does not require to be caught and transported to a disposal center. If a chemical cleaner has to be used for stress cleaning, take the complying with actions: Get in touch with EHS to get a map of the storm drains around the job website.



This can include tarps, berms, storm drain covers or mats, pipeline plugs, pumps, and so on. Notify EHS of the process for disposal of the wastewater. Wastewater can be pumped right into the hygienic drain only with OWASA authorization. The various other option is to collect the wastewater in a drum or storage tank and get rid of offsite for disposal at an authorized wastewater center.

Pressure washing in some locations need extra precautions to make sure that the products being washed do not go into the storm drain system.


Drainage from those areas must be captured and not permitted to discharge into storm drains. Oil and food waste that spills or sprays onto the ground should be cleaned up using completely dry approaches such as absorbing materials or store vacs. If degreaser will be called for, get in touch with EHS for assistance with a clean-up strategy that will include blocking the storm drains pipes and collecting wastewater.




Packing dock trench drains and floor drains pipes attached to the tornado drainpipe system: Do not stress clean grease or food waste off of these packing docks. If stress washing is needed to clean spills, get in touch with EHS for a clean-up plan that will include blocking the drains pipes and collecting wastewater. Inspect for leaking dumpsters or vehicle fluid splashes or leaks.


(https://zenwriting.net/martzpwashing/roof-cleaning-and-screen-enclosure-cleaning-why-its-essential-for-your-home)If the packing dock is or else free from liquid contamination, follow the stress cleaning actions detailed above. Debris tracked off building and construction websites of any type of size should not be washed right into tornado drains pipes. Debris needs to be cleansed using just dry approaches (road sweeper, mops, shovels, and so on).
